The cover art is by painter Keisuke Kondo, the photo by photographer Masumi Kawamura, and the design by Akira Sasaki, art director of HEADZ.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003c!----\u003e","brand":"SHOP windandwindows","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":49461043298624,"sku":"","price":2500.0,"currency_code":"JPY","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0840\/9727\/0080\/files\/POPOOGA.jpg?v=1722994726"},{"product_id":"kk","title":"KK (Single)","description":"\u003cp\u003e\u003cmeta charset=\"utf-8\"\u003e \u003cspan\u003eShuta Hasunuma's first field recording will be released on June 13, 2023.\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n \u003cp\u003e\u003cspan\u003eField recordings were made while walking along the Kumano Kodo, a World Heritage Site. This work is a single track composed of environmental sounds from six locations along the Kumano Kodo, over two days of fieldwork. Recordings included Takijiri-oji, Mizunomi-oji, Takagen Kirinosato, Kawayu Onsen, Oyunohara, and the confluence of the Kumano River, Otonashi River, and Iwata River. A limited-time store where these works will be exhibited and sold will be open until May 24th at ComMunE on the 10th floor of Shibuya PARCO in Tokyo. \"Picnic\" is a piece that has been compiled into a single song by reconstructing the sound work output from four speakers, which Hasunuma created as background music for the venue.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"SHOP windandwindows","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":50966974562624,"sku":null,"price":0.0,"currency_code":"JPY","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0840\/9727\/0080\/files\/glab_hasumura_cover_2-01-copy-2.jpg?v=1755094135"},{"product_id":"oa","title":"Oa (EP)","description":"\u003cp\u003eShuta Hasunuma's new album, \"Oa,\" was released on cassette tape and digitally on September 27, 2019, by the New York-based label Northern Spy Records.\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e Titled \"Oa,\" which stands for \"Old address,\" the album contains four tracks produced in 2017 when Hasunuma was living in Manhattan. The track titles \"454\" refer to his apartment room number, \"BORO\" to the Queensboro Bridge that can be seen from the room, \"LEX\" to the Lexington Avenue subway station, and \"20170716\" to the recording date.\u003cbr\u003e \u003cbr\u003eAlthough he was in a slump at the time, Hasunuma created these four songs with the belief that devoting himself to production at all times was a reflection of \"who he is now.\" Two years later, upon listening to the recordings again, he was reminded of his memories of the time of production and the place where he lived, and he gave the album a new mix to complete the work. This album, in which Hasunuma reminisces about the passage of time and reflects on the history of Manhattan, is a personal soundscape for him.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"SHOP windandwindows","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":50973657432384,"sku":null,"price":0.0,"currency_code":"JPY","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0840\/9727\/0080\/files\/oa-780-1.jpg?v=1755326669"},{"product_id":"ok-bamboo","title":"OK Bamboo","description":"\u003cp\u003e Much like the bamboo plants that dominate Japan's landscape, Shuta Hasunuma's piano work on his new album OK Bamboo has an enduring, simple elegance. OK Bamboo's title and compositions are the result of Hasunuma's interest in the ancient relationship between Japan and bamboo. As he explains, “In Japan, bamboo is revered as a plant sharing properties of both wood and grass. It also has an enduring and remarkable strength. After bombings in times of war, when all of the people are killed and the buildings destroyed, often the bamboo plants are all that's left standing.”\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e Each track flits and twitters, growing and changing without warning.
